4 / 5

Good tyre

- Florian, 2 August, 2023

Some difficulty getting it onto the wheel because of the stiffness of the rods, but once in place the seal is perfect. No loss of pressure. However, I was a little disappointed with the weight, which was higher than the 650g advertised. The one I received weighed 712g, which is 10% more, which is not insignificant.

4 / 5

For use in the Netherlands a light running top band!!!

- Willem, 1 February, 2022

Tyre is suitable in various conditions. In really muddy conditions, the tyre falls a little short. The tyre runs light on the road and on average forest trails. If you ride the tyre tubeless get the maximum performance out of it as you can ride with less pressure in tougher conditions.

Pros & Cons

easy to make tubeless
little rolling resistance
Sufficient grip in average conditions
less suitable in heavy muddy conditions

4 / 5

Good tyre with plenty of grip

- Peter, 25 August, 2021

I bought the 2.35. Nice and wide, nice profile, nice tyre. Very difficult to fit. You only get it on with two tyre levers and a lot of Dreft. And you also have to inflate it very hard before it pops into the rim (only works with detergent for lubrication). Considering the weight, I would choose the 2.25 next time. The brown sidewalls are also lighter than the black ones.

Pros & Cons

Lots of grip
rolls very lightly
Steers nicely
Heavy (2.35)
Very difficult to mount
